PHOENICIA, Tyre. 126/5 BC-AD 65/6. AR Shekel (25mm, 14.13 g, 1h). Dated CY 143 (AD 17/8). Laureate head of Melkart right, [lion skin around neck] / Eagle standing left on prow; palm frond in background; to left, PMΓ (date) above club; to right, KP above monogram; Phoenician B between legs. DCA-Tyre 505; RPC I 4656; HGC 10, 357; DCA 920. VF, darkly toned, trace deposits, struck with worn obverse die.


From the B. H. Webb Collection. Ex George Prager Collection (Classical Numismatic Group 36, 5 Dec 1995), lot 2152.
